How it started
At the AI Summit Series 2025 at the Jacob Javits Center in New York, my team and I were brainstorming project ideas across the weekend. One thread kept surfacing. Mental health, specifically how few people have the freedom to keep a digital private journal that supports them in a personalized way and stays local to them. We took that gap and built Thera AI around it.
02
What we built
A journaling surface backed by multilingual agents built with Python, Hugging Face, and OpenAI. Mood and emotion analytics roll up into a dashboard. A weather layer adds environmental signals, so if the data suggests a low-light, low-movement day is dragging mood, the agent can recommend a mood-elevating location nearby.
03
Outcome
We finished as runners-up in the Fetch.AI Innovation Lab track. More importantly, it was my first serious agentic build, and the handoff between analytics, translation, and recommendation agents is a pattern I have reused since.
